Historical shareholding details of Brandes Investment Partners & Co holdings in Icon Plc (ICLR)

Monthly changes of Brandes Investment Partners & Co shareholding in Icon Plc over the previous months

Month Name Total no. shares held Percent Holding
Jun 30, 2025 Brandes Investment Partners & Co 207,533 0.27%

View all ownership details of Icon Plc